£8,000 a Week After Tax 2025-26
That's £416,000/year gross · Weekly salary take-home pay UK
£8,000/week tax breakdown 2025-26
| Item | Annual | Monthly | Weekly |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ross salary | £416,000 | £34,667 | £8,000 |
| Personal Allowance (tax-free) |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Income Tax | −£174,032 | −£14,503 | −£3,347 |
| National Insurance | −£10,331 | −£861 | −£199 |
| Net take-home | £231,637 | £19,303 | £4,455 |
Scotland vs England: £8,000/week after tax
In Scotland, £8,000/week takes home £7,658 less than in England (£638/month difference) due to Scotland's different income tax bands.
£8,000 a week — what does that mean annually?
£8,000 per week × 52 weeks = £416,000 annual gross salary. After Income Tax and National Insurance in 2025-26, your take-home pay is £231,637 per year.
That works out as £19,303 per month and £4,455 per week take-home. Your effective tax rate (Income Tax + NI as a percentage of gross) is 44.32%.
Out of £416,000, you pay £174,032 in Income Tax and £10,331 in National Insurance, leaving £231,637 take-home pay.
